I've asked Tom Cooper, author of the "Iraqi Mirages" https://g.co/kgs/hS7j2v about the radar on Mirage F1, and his answer is:

Mirage F.1-radar.... The Iraqis were using the Cyrano-IVQ, which was much better than the radar of the MiG-21, and even that of the MiG-23MF, but not as good as that of the MiG-23ML. Later versions, like IVQ-M (Mirage F.1EQ-5/6), had a MTI and were matching the radar of the MiG-23ML. AFAIK, the F.1CE is 'F.1C brought to F.1EQ-5/6 standard' (like the F.1CT).

This is wrong.

Mirage F1 CE is just Spain variant of the Mirage F1 C.

Mirage F1 EE is a Mirage F1 C with INS navigation system.

 

Mirage F1 EQ5/6 were totally multirole:

- AA with Super 530F (not Super 530D contrary to what he published multiple times), and Magic.

- AG with dumb bombs, laser guided weapons such as BGL and AS30L.

- anti-ship with AM39

- anti-radar with BAZ-AR (export of ARMAT)

- kind of jamming export with REMORA pod.

 

Nobody else got the full kit.

So, were the F1CE compatible with Super 530F? Or only with the old 530?

 

I'm not sure.

I would say it's an easy modification. But given the fact they didn't have Super 530F before procuring former Qataris Mirage F1 EDA, they probably didn't do it.

 

Spain bought EF/A-18A (C.15) in the 1980', upgrading the Mirage F1 was probably a lower priority.

 

It would be wise for Aerges to make a French Mirage F1 C-200, apart from the weapons, it's very close to the CE.
